Angel Vine 2011 Alder Ridge Vineyard Zinfandel, Horse Heaven Hills, $20
By Great Northwest Wine on February 8, 2014
It’s not feasible for Ed Fus to grow Zinfandel among his Pinot Noir vines in Oregon’s Eola-Amity Hills, so he relies on several growers in Washington to feed that need for big reds. This four-barrel selection comes from Winemakers LLC’s blustery site west of Paterson, and the wine produces aromas of raspberry-chocolate sauce, black cherry reduction, plum skin and white pepper. On the pour is a rich entry of raspberry, plums and pomegranate, making for a juicy Zin that’s far from cloying.
Rating: Excellent
Production: 100 cases
Alcohol: 14.6%
